RE: For discussion: scope for AltSvc and ORIGIN bis efforts

Mike Bishop <mbishop@evequefou.be> Thu, 05 November 2020 20:00 UTC

Return-Path: <ietf-http-wg-request+bounce-httpbisa-archive-bis2juki=lists.ie@listhub.w3.org>
X-Original-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Delivered-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 702283A1AA0 for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Thu, 5 Nov 2020 12:00:21 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.648
X-Spam-Level:
X-Spam-Status: No, score=-2.648 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HEADER_FROM_DIFFERENT_DOMAINS=0.25, MAILING_LIST_MULTI=-1, RCVD_IN_MSPIKE_H4=0.001, RCVD_IN_MSPIKE_WL=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=evequefou.onmicrosoft.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id jSugUyO1gSce for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Thu, 5 Nov 2020 12:00:19 -0800 (PST)
Received: from lyra.w3.org (lyra.w3.org [128.30.52.18]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 711573A1A2B for <httpbisa-archive-bis2Juki@lists.ietf.org>; Thu, 5 Nov 2020 12:00:16 -0800 (PST)
Received: from lists by lyra.w3.org with local (Exim 4.92) (envelope-from <ietf-http-wg-request@listhub.w3.org>) id 1kalOM-0006Sk-Dn for ietf-http-wg-dist@listhub.w3.org; Thu, 05 Nov 2020 19:57:54 +0000
Resent-Date: Thu, 05 Nov 2020 19:57:54 +0000
Resent-Message-Id: <E1kalOM-0006Sk-Dn@lyra.w3.org>
Received: from titan.w3.org ([128.30.52.76]) by lyra.w3.org with esmtps (TLS1.3: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from <mbishop@evequefou.be>) id 1kalOJ-0006Ry-WB for ietf-http-wg@listhub.w3.org; Thu, 05 Nov 2020 19:57:52 +0000
Received: from mail-bn7nam10on2128.outbound.protection.outlook.com ([40.107.92.128] helo=NAM10-BN7-obe.outbound.protection.outlook.com) by titan.w3.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from <mbishop@evequefou.be>) id 1kalOH-0008NO-N8 for ietf-http-wg@w3.org; Thu, 05 Nov 2020 19:57:51 +0000
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=b+K1W4N7EsfSio7FFxGaAseXx1OVLvHfP6N+4AJ3D24IJWZHxd9uDI+ksogQ9Ey22kdujjuevN6Ehuwf8xTpyjKHEmkTIUsxlc+5F+4a/516G1jL8QrER7REMl1JncjGbbgpg1NAuBX4vo4IUWEjuHhkiVkptzx9Gqp6G9VWQaGLWqaMYYusxfar/NTUehDF3TfypYSMt03NhO+IiWmsuEnECVNHwtEBCnmseLDLcBy+BnWHEyUepxQXfILuYlpevbpCOSXuRGr2PDeTocR5wQ+KvUda2ozA7I3d9X602jY7Gr+ZZ9oNwybYhY+/j9G+czdhwosF5PDiNlxPKsg6FA==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=EksFfhDcCSiDgnwv3WsqV7W1attCRNdvvqf81iroKwo=; b=EWGgQiyx3h8y6dYMzhp+x3Xl5HvzzcXpK+exuKi5EDhDnmyOGTuLrpbnCWG/14EzNg48LDJ6/ScZkQfDTEIp0DMiKjCqF8ZyysSet5cp6CzXgBpi14klCqYF/s63/ykG3kB3cmDFCaYqbibr+tQqTnLnLa3I4nldPiuKKC2ezVSxOMCxNEBphEPENno1Gj0dRrRv31jOnwpDZaxewlg/2/yH/2mHsEM3bZvbP3s2l4hMYG6VR+iDZ0nBgHTyqR3tjmVXktsbLWyDKT4EgxIILWkVN/HgrxsqOggeS0uiP8jKBNtLiR04FIgMS+5YC5My0yxHa/DSxtHj3dJ9/Marjw==
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=evequefou.be; dmarc=pass action=none header.from=evequefou.be; dkim=pass header.d=evequefou.be; arc=none
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=evequefou.onmicrosoft.com; s=selector2-evequefou-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=EksFfhDcCSiDgnwv3WsqV7W1attCRNdvvqf81iroKwo=; b=NbkJXbz7xhZLFc3aiIz2nwMAOqDG3r2tCJbQqXDNQSI6gN3fo0Q/YZF3/9ycg3xYQ4K/p89m+Tr3eo9EkQTSW0Ghp3RORq39zs+EP1kaFhIixSOgSk8Z3qzYSBWOx3oW6ctaHHSybpHDAaf8kAbx1oIHAH6WIyn6n3o78B+D8pE=
Received: from CH2PR22MB2086.namprd22.prod.outlook.com (2603:10b6:610:8c::8) by CH2PR22MB2007.namprd22.prod.outlook.com (2603:10b6:610:84::22)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3541.21; Thu, 5 Nov 2020 19:57:37 +0000
Received: from CH2PR22MB2086.namprd22.prod.outlook.com ([fe80::5c87:a789:7ed6:8687]) by CH2PR22MB2086.namprd22.prod.outlook.com ([fe80::5c87:a789:7ed6:8687%3]) with mapi id 15.20.3541.021; Thu, 5 Nov 2020 19:57:37 +0000
From: Mike Bishop <mbishop@evequefou.be>
To: Mark Nottingham <mnot@mnot.net>, HTTP Working Group <ietf-http-wg@w3.org>
CC: Tommy Pauly <tpauly@apple.com>, Erik Nygren <erik+ietf@nygren.org>, David Benjamin <davidben@google.com>
Thread-Topic: For discussion: scope for AltSvc and ORIGIN bis efforts
Thread-Index: AQHWsvsUadVmRKhgz0ebY5KnWg9LIKm58vEQ
Date: Thu, 05 Nov 2020 19:57:37 +0000
Message-ID: <CH2PR22MB2086E2536BF74C5DAF8B1D0FDAEE0@CH2PR22MB2086.namprd22.prod.outlook.com>
References: <BBA5F9B9-7788-41DA-853E-FADD7EF20B24@mnot.net>
In-Reply-To: <BBA5F9B9-7788-41DA-853E-FADD7EF20B24@mnot.net>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ach: yes
X-MS-TNEF-Correlator:
authentication-results: mnot.net; dkim=none (message not signed) header.d=none;mnot.net; dmarc=none action=none header.from=evequefou.be;
x-originating-ip: [72.49.212.17]
x-ms-publictraffictype: Email
x-ms-office365-filtering-correlation-id: baf7ed07-38c9-466d-6bb6-08d881c50baf
x-ms-traffictypediagnostic: CH2PR22MB2007:
x-microsoft-antispam-prvs: <CH2PR22MB20070B8166AC6BBE25E478EDDAEE0@CH2PR22MB2007.namprd22.prod.outlook.com>
x-ms-oob-tlc-oobclassifiers: OLM:10000;
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am: BCL:0;
x-microsoft-antispam-message-info: XqRQrC2BKszXzBWcU910fw+YN68QwKjhp++l+F4C1uTxyhZbh8SCyMLDSW8ifVGqXC/MoEgMnSsNZQoY7al1KGw7kT2ttnesJfa2eu836BCFsTL8VJsqLUPxKL0IURHUpXTeqlWKgHziYOdpcmNBoX6OrzBBGKED/bw1+IJvr/oFG+ZQXLQ4oP7CCfq8YADixN/neYgDP58YPBeScWp5l1nLoBO4RqmyDYljxO/xab6Nj1j2mAdlWShJygaYDiXRjuJ/gumisVsM5b2bOmuGujreoYUwNuYMx2zWOuFsHSrrIYb0NH3Gkg1ZUCEYPcHBo5gfFUFXb4nkrW3Hqpl8er9EXeMJRCv8iKKIqFq8S8O5lcJ9oDrMY6LOi6hfGfE08RmBF33hOAtBEYECR8HtFQ==
x-forefront-antispam-report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:CH2PR22MB2086.namprd22.prod.outlook.com;PTR:;CAT:NONE;SFS:(366004)(346002)(136003)(39830400003)(396003)(376002)(316002)(99936003)(9686003)(4326008)(55016002)(5660300002)(186003)(86362001)(71200400001)(83380400001)(54906003)(110136005)(6506007)(33656002)(76116006)(66946007)(8936002)(8676002)(53546011)(66476007)(64756008)(7696005)(478600001)(52536014)(66446008)(66556008)(966005)(2906002)(66616009)(26005);DIR:OUT;SFP:1102;
x-ms-exchange-antispam-messagedata: lKkR3tnplRvw5I1sNEEyXfZq4O6GzlXtHiDg7HhTIlpb0b7LDJFpmT6hrFwjFRKKJbmTsqotv90BMQi8S6YpkD4bFjFVPcxx8s6DLzID0nAXz7+sZWf9di5wuiD0c2knwBDEHscBtp13qIoxNsFs5/55B+w/Pveig9TSagjEC/kRVsuKdqr8AWpo6IV40ORhPukfwXAHVIh30/le5AQI35vIGYeXc6R1vi2EkJsMWzRwJxXVvreAMvcKfw5w51EefGdi3ERgv/RCfXhM8gmrN6kYnzCbSkjurbnLcQmRKWrNCbXblcxyyPej09tae8MEU8oOZZ3RgJ1kAYu7nKHQk8sZvaDDOwUCw/hCBBKCud1N7xxG7mghpjrTteV0E5IBDrFRxaTUc4+2+hPnUSzAwzr+QEgbjWnZ7MB+HlN8TUaGj5C63viEK1E7I7Y4eHPj7ePpLXFJ5+2sxTpt5cn3FBHLZfu+AhZHX/9o1GpSUqZchcSTaqVd+4vH9Q1smm8YZ63ET3EnbpEqTS1bPuCgUKfzbOzBHMzxejAdiU92KS2uecTyoSKNEEPrIPiBIcmlPmILSdJfuO1i4rFsj1jUDaJMF/uZpwoo3089V/Z6FAE8yLImKs8GQaA6oxdTjKX5az02a0rj/Va+CnCDyshNyw==
x-ms-exchange-transport-forked: True
Content-Type: multipart/signed; protocol="application/x-pkcs7-signature"; micalg="2.16.840.1.101.3.4.2.1"; boundary="----=_NextPart_000_0043_01D6B383.FF88EE60"
MIME-Version: 1.0
X-OriginatorOrg: evequefou.be
X-MS-Exchange-CrossTenant-AuthAs: Internal
X-MS-Exchange-CrossTenant-AuthSource: CH2PR22MB2086.namprd22.prod.outlook.com
X-MS-Exchange-CrossTenant-Network-Message-Id: baf7ed07-38c9-466d-6bb6-08d881c50baf
X-MS-Exchange-CrossTenant-originalarrivaltime: 05 Nov 2020 19:57:37.6157 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 41eaf50b-882d-47eb-8c4c-0b5b76a9da8f
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: SG+xTkzzR6EJgPYQhj2ksZyvWcEVDIo7eVjMKmWZWPsn4gFy7CeUuH/e0rHPaVVMGZjP5WIgijvcAaCqFRQAeg==
X-MS-Exchange-Transport-CrossTenantHeadersStamped: CH2PR22MB2007
Received-SPF: pass client-ip=40.107.92.128; envelope-from=mbishop@evequefou.be; helo=NAM10-BN7-obe.outbound.protection.outlook.com
X-W3C-Hub-Spam-Status: No, score=-3.9
X-W3C-Hub-Spam-Report: B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H2=-0.001,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001, W3C_AA=-1, W3C_WL=-1
X-W3C-Scan-Sig: titan.w3.org 1kalOH-0008NO-N8 050983536360137e0b0ea6c5b3593a97
X-Original-To: ietf-http-wg@w3.org
Subject: RE: For discussion: scope for AltSvc and ORIGIN bis efforts
Archived-At: <https://www.w3.org/mid/CH2PR22MB2086E2536BF74C5DAF8B1D0FDAEE0@CH2PR22MB2086.namprd22.prod.outlook.com>
Resent-From: ietf-http-wg@w3.org
X-Mailing-List: <ietf-http-wg@w3.org> archive/latest/38189
X-Loop: ietf-http-wg@w3.org
Resent-Sender: ietf-http-wg-request@w3.org
Precedence: list
List-Id: <ietf-http-wg.w3.org>
List-Help: <https://www.w3.org/Mail/>
List-Post: <mailto:ietf-http-wg@w3.org>
List-Unsubscribe: <mailto:ietf-http-wg-request@w3.org?subject=unsubscribe>

Given that there is at least some interest in discussing substantive changes 
to Alt-Svc following the design of HTTPS/SVCB, it seems odd to consider a bis 
and a potential tre in relatively quick succession.  However, that discussion 
might not lead to a new document, so we need to pick something to do in the 
meantime.

I think it would be cleaner to do a patch-only fix to this issue and leave a 
full revised document for that discussion if it materializes.  However, I have 
no objection to bis documents in the meantime if that's the preferred approach 
in the WG.

-----Original Message-----
From: Mark Nottingham <mnot@mnot.net>
Sent: Wednesday, November 4, 2020 5:37 PM
To: HTTP Working Group <ietf-http-wg@w3.org>
Cc: Tommy Pauly <tpauly@apple.com>
Subject: For discussion: scope for AltSvc and ORIGIN bis efforts

At the interim, we discussed Mike's draft to revise some HTTP/2 extensions to 
work with HTTP/3:
https://datatracker.ietf.org/doc/html/draft-bishop-httpbis-altsvc-quic

After discussion, the most viable way forward seemed to be to revise both of 
those documents to include HTTP/2 and HTTP/3 mechanisms, rather than just 
creating a "patch" RFC that updates them for HTTP/3.

The Chairs support doing so, but want to see a well-defined scope of work for 
the effort.

As a starting point, we believe that the following should be in-scope for the 
effort:

* Porting the ORIGIN and ALTSVC frames to HTTP/3
* Incorporating errata
* Editorial improvements

Other changes would be out of scope. In particular, anything that is 
incompatible with the current definition or use of these frames in HTTP/2 
would not be suitable.

However, improvements in how they are specified could be in-scope, provided 
that there is strong consensus to include them.

Comments on this scope -- including proposals for additions -- are welcome; 
we'll issue a Call for Adoption if we can get to a general agreement about 
that.

Cheers,

Mark and Tommy